my hard drive is failing (running Red Hat 7.0) and last night i discovered
it making the insidious 'clicking sound' only when trying to log to
/var/log/messages or /var/log/secure.  when i took a look at messages i
discovered it had grown to over 11 gigs (don't ask me how) and i couldn't
read then end of the file (obviously). someone had hit me 5 times per
second for nearly 12 hours! i'm assuming this might have to do with the
ramen worm.  anyway...i simply removed both messages and secure and
'touched' new files in their places.

could this physical error be due to the oversized file (and the attempts
to write to it)?
